Street Food in Thailand

The Exquisite Street Eats of Thailand

Pad Thai: A Taste of Heaven

Take a stroll through the bustling streets of Thailand and let the aroma of Pad Thai tantalize your taste buds. This mouthwatering stir-fried noodle masterpiece combines delicate rice noodles, succulent shrimp or chicken, velvety tofu, crisp bean sprouts, and delectable eggs. The flavors of tamarind paste, fish sauce, sugar, and lime juice dance harmoniously in this savory and subtly sweet dish. Embellished with crushed peanuts and a zesty squeeze of fresh lime, Pad Thai has become a cherished treasure among both locals and tourists.

Mango Sticky Rice: A Tropical Symphony

Indulge your sweet tooth in a heavenly dessert unique to Thailand – Mango Sticky Rice. Picture a heavenly melding of tender sticky rice bathed in luscious coconut milk, adorned with succulent slices of ripe mango, and crowned with a sprinkle of toasted sesame seeds. The delicate creaminess of the coconut milk perfectly complements the juicy sweetness of the mango, creating a symphony of flavors that will transport your taste buds to paradise.

Tom Yum Goong: Spicy Elixir of the Senses

For those with an adventurous palate, Tom Yum Goong promises a sensory adventure. This spicy and tangy soup concoction teems with tantalizing flavors. Envelope your senses in the aromatic embrace of lemongrass, kaffir lime leaves, and galangal. Savor the succulent shrimp, the earthy mushrooms and relish the invigorating zest of fresh lime juice. The interplay of spicy, sour, and savory notes leaves a memorable impression and has elevated Tom Yum Goong to an overwhelming favorite among locals and tourists alike.

Som Tam (Papaya Salad): A Symphony of Freshness

Seeking a revitalizing and wholesome street food option? Look no further than the vibrant delight of Som Tam, also known as Papaya Salad. Revel in a burst of freshness as you savor the harmonious medley of shredded green papaya, juicy cherry tomatoes, crisp green beans, crunchy peanuts, and a tantalizing dressing of lime juice, fish sauce, garlic, and chilies. Brace yourself for an explosion of flavors, blending the sweetness, tanginess, and spiciness that will leave you craving more.

Discovering the charm of South Korea

Unveiling the Enchantment of South Korea

Seoul

Seoul, the captivating capital of South Korea, is a lively metropolis that seamlessly blends old-world charm with contemporary marvels. Enveloped in a dynamic atmosphere, Seoul presents a one-of-a-kind experience for explorers. Meander through the enchanting Bukchon Hanok Village, witness the grandeur of the Gyeongbokgung Palace, or relish in delectable street delicacies at the bustling Myeongdong district. Do not miss the opportunity to immerse yourself in the vibrant nightlife and infectious K-pop culture of Hongdae and Gangnam.

Gyeongju

Gyeongju, often hailed as the “living museum,” stands as a city steeped in history and overflowing with cultural heritage. Once the capital of the ancient Silla Kingdom, Gyeongju is now a sanctuary of numerous UNESCO World Heritage Sites. Traverse the awe-inspiring Bulguksa Temple, admire the picturesque Anapji Pond, and meander through the historic Tumuli Park, where ancient tombs and artifacts await. Gyeongju offers a serene and captivating glimpse into the bygone era of South Korea.

Jeju Island

Jeju Island, nestled off the southern coast of South Korea, offers a veritable haven adorned with breathtaking natural landscapes. From cascading waterfalls and volcanic craters to idyllic beaches and vibrant flower fields, Jeju Island is a feast for the senses. Embark on a hike up Hallasan, the highest peak in South Korea, discover the dramatic cliffs of Jusangjeolli, or simply unwind on the picturesque shores of Seongsan Ilchulbong. On Jeju Island, an immersion into nature’s wonders awaits.

Busan

Busan, South Korea’s bustling second-largest city, intertwines urban allure with scenic splendor effortlessly. With its renowned coastlines, vibrant markets, and mouthwatering seafood gastronomy, Busan offers a refreshing change of scenery. Explore the exquisite Haeundae Beach, delve into the bustling Jagalchi Fish Market, or saunter along the picturesque streets of Gamcheon Culture Village. Do not forget to relish the breathtaking vistas from the iconic Busan Tower and soak in the vibrant atmosphere at Gwangalli Beach.

When is the Ideal Time to Explore Asia?

Unveiling the perfect season to set foot in Asia requires understanding the unique climatic conditions of each country or region you plan to visit. On a broad scale, sp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) are considered the best times to embark on an Asian adventure. During these months, temperatures are pleasant, and tourist crowds are relatively smaller. However, travelers should take into account specific festivals, climate patterns, and activities of interest when planning their itinerary for each Asian destination.

Understanding Cultural Customs in Asia

Asia is a culturally vibrant continent, with each country boasting its own unique customs and traditions. Observing and respecting local customs while traveling in Asia is crucial. Some common cultural practices to be aware of include dressing modestly, removing shoes before entering temples or homes, showing respect to elders, refraining from public displays of affection, and familiarizing oneself with essential phrases in the local language. Embracing and honoring the local culture can profoundly enrich the overall travel experience in Asia.
